Numbers 6.1 で、数字フォーマットでは16桁の下一桁が四捨五入される。

従前のNumbersで作成していた表の一つのセルのデーターが変わってしまった。

16桁のデーターの下一桁が四捨五入され、87だったのが90に変わってしまった。

その時点ではデーターフォーマットは数字でした。

ちなみに自動フォーマットにして再入力すれば下一桁まで表示されます。

iMacでも、iPhoneでも同じなので、Nimbersのバグではと疑っています。

Nubersのバージョンが6.1になっていて、それが原因ではないかと思っています。

投稿日 2019/07/19 20:38

返信
返信: 31

2019/07/20 06:31 顕夫 への返信

 横から失礼いたします。


 計算しないのでしたら "テキスト" の方が良いのかも。


 ところで、私のところでも現象を確認したので、私もフィードバックを送ってみました。

 品川地蔵さんがご紹介のサポート記事を読んだ感じと、T22Tさんのご指摘の 少数の桁数 設定時の挙動からすると不具合のようにも思ったのですが、「フィードバックの種類:」は"機能に関するリクエスト"としました。

2019/07/20 23:42 木藤 への返信

スレ主さんは、最初に表示と書いてますし、品川地蔵さんも入力(入力直後のセルがアクティブな状態では四捨五入されない)しただけで四捨五入と書いてますね。

16桁の数字を入力後のエンターキーを押した時に四捨五入されることを問題にしているようなので、その段階では演算や数値を参照するしないこととは違う事だと思います。


2019/07/20 20:23 onesize への返信

> 表計算ソフトに於いて、入力値が16桁というのは一般的ではないとは思います


ごく一般的ですよ。少なくとも割合最近までは。ちょっと古めのバージョンの表計算ソフトで20桁ぐらい表示させてちょっと計算させてみれば無茶苦茶な結果になるので簡単にわかります。

計算だけでなくて大小比較も要注意です。大小比較や等しいかどうかの判定をさせると、15、6桁目の誤差のために判定が誤ったものになることはしょっちゅうあります。なので、そういう誤差に影響されないように注意して行えと最初に教えられます。

15桁以上も必要な計算をしたいなら、数値計算の誤差にも配慮して注意を払うべきということです。


このスレッドはシステム、またはAppleコミュニティチームによってロックされました。 問題解決の参考になる情報であれば、どの投稿にでも投票いただけます。またコミュニティで他の回答を検索することもできます。

Numbers 6.1 で、数字フォーマットでは16桁の下一桁が四捨五入される。

Apple サポートコミュニティへようこそ
Apple ユーザ同士でお使いの製品について助け合うフォーラムです。Apple Account を使ってご参加ください。